DO state that the offer is subject to the employee's provision of I-9 documentation, as well as any other contingencies required for the job, such as reference checks, drug tests and/or background checks. DON'T include promises about promotions, pay raises or bonuses in the offer letter.

Summary. Most letters given to an employee by an employer do not destroy the at-will relationship. However, if an offer letter lists a specific length of time in which the employment will last, it could be deemed an employment contract by the courts.
